Transaction 7e6a214fc442209214a35d2f60d806a7b6d99096c4c7f6b56cac007958c33797

1 Input
2 Outputs
  • 7e6a214fc442209214a35d2f60d806a7b6d99096c4c7f6b56cac007958c33797:0
  • value  500000000
    address  399ovDLkWB46Uuf21TLq94wQ9bD4sBxHGr
  • 7e6a214fc442209214a35d2f60d806a7b6d99096c4c7f6b56cac007958c33797:1
  • value  2699983292
    address  3LYhA8pPC23dEBDxv2YfCNJPSMK7Kw7ybx